Mining Operations and Resource Development

In 2-3 short paragraphs of plain English, what does EDM (EDM) actually do? Who pays them and why? What is the core business model?

EDM Resources (EDM) is a mining company focused on the exploration and development of mineral resources, particularly gold, at its Scotia Mine located in Halifax County, Nova Scotia. The company aims to restart operations at this mine, which has been a significant asset for EDM, and is currently advancing through various regulatory and permitting processes to facilitate this. EDM's core business model revolves around extracting valuable minerals and selling them in the market, primarily targeting investors and stakeholders interested in gold and other minerals. The company generates revenue by selling the minerals it extracts to various buyers, including industrial users and commodity traders. Recent EDM Material News

What is the most recent material news for EDM? Summarize the top 3 items from the last 90 days and explain why each matters for shareholders.

The most recent material news for EDM Resources (EDM) includes the following top three items from the last 90 days: 1. EDM Announces DTC Eligibility for Electronic Settlement of Trades in the United States (August 13, 2026) - This news is significant as it allows EDM's common shares to be electronically cleared and settled in the U.S. through The Depository Trust Company (DTC). This milestone enhances accessibility for U.S. investors, potentially increasing trading volume and liquidity, which is beneficial for shareholders. 2. EDM Receives Amended Industrial Approval for Scotia Mine Restart (July 20, 2026) - The Nova Scotia Department of Environment and Climate Change issued an amended Industrial Approval for the Scotia Mine, which is crucial for the planned restart of operations. This approval represents a major regulatory milestone, indicating progress in the company's efforts to resume mining activities, which could lead to increased revenue and shareholder value. 3. EDM Announces Second Quarter 2026 Update and Advancement of Key Milestones (July 7, 2026) - In this update, EDM highlighted significant progress in permitting, capital markets, and project development, including the commencement of trading on the OTCQB Venture Market. This progress is vital as it positions the company for future growth and enhances its visibility in the market, which can positively impact investor sentiment and share performance.

EDM Bear Case Risks

Make the bear case for EDM in 4-6 tight bullets. Lead with the most important risk. Be specific about what could go wrong and what to watch.

The bear case for EDM (EDM) includes the following risks: - Regulatory Risks : The company is dependent on obtaining and maintaining necessary permits for the Scotia Mine. Delays or rejections in the permitting process could significantly hinder operations and timelines. - Market Volatility : Fluctuations in commodity prices, particularly gold and zinc, could adversely affect the company's profitability and project viability. A downturn in market prices may lead to reduced investor interest and funding challenges. - Operational Challenges : Restarting the Scotia Mine involves complex operational logistics. Any unforeseen technical difficulties or cost overruns during the restart could impact financial performance and timelines. - Dependence on U.S. Market Access : While EDM has achieved DTC eligibility for electronic settlement in the U.S., reliance on U.S. investors could pose risks if market conditions change or if there are regulatory hurdles that affect trading. - Financial Health Concerns : Although recent warrant exercises have strengthened the treasury, ongoing funding needs for exploration and development may require additional capital raises, which could dilute existing shareholders. - Competition : The mining sector is competitive, and EDM faces challenges from other mining companies in Atlantic Canada. Failure to effectively position itself against peers could limit growth and market share.
